Child Shutsdown Wal-martPosted Tuesday, December 30, 2008, at 1:20 PM
:) Having young children we love to get out and just ride around the town and look. On Christmas eve was the case. As we rode through town I began to see the power of God everywhere--- At Wal-mart at Burger King at Subway and Kroger. The power of God all over town! I stared in amazement as I considered how that the birth of a child over 2000 years ago could still effect us in such a dramatic way. The birth of Jesus shut down Shelbyville and many other cities around the world for a few days. That's power!
